Stable flies cause similar weight gain losses to both pasture and confinement cattle. The life cycle of the stable fly can take 14-24 days in Nebraska, depending on weather conditions. Yearling cattle can also be affected by the horn fly; other studies have shown yearling weights can be reduced by as much as 18 percent. Horn flies can also transmit some blood borne diseases. Keeping fly control mineral out long enough in the fall is just as important to control flies as providing it early enough in the spring (30 days before the last frost).
